Recommended NMR literature

Here is a compilation of recommended literature for users endeavoring to deepen their understanding in NMR. The subsequent list reflects our personal preferences (by Dimitrios & Ivan), and those resources that we have deemed beneficial over the years.

Basic Principles:

  1. C. P. Slichter, Principles of Magnetic Resonance, 3rd ed. (Springer, Berlin, 1980).
  2. J. Keeler, Understanding NMR Spectroscopy, 2nd ed. (Wiley, Chichester, 2010).
  3. M. H. Levitt, Spin Dynamics. Basics of Nuclear Magnetic Resonance, 2nd Edition (Wiley, Chichester, 2007).

Solution-state NMR:

  1. T. D. W. Claridge, High-Resolution NMR Technique in Organic Chemistry, 3rd ed. (Elsevier, 2016).
  2. N. E. Jacobsen, NMR Spectroscopy Explained: Simplified Theory, Applications and Examples for Organic Chemistry and Structural Biology, (John Wiley & Sons, Inc., 2007).

Solid-state NMR:

  1. E. O. Stejskal, J. D. Memory, High Resolution NMR in the Solid State, Fundamentals of CP/MAS, Oxford University Press, 1994.
  2. M. Mehring, Principles of High-Resolution NMR in Solids, 2nd ed. (Springer-Verlag, Berlin, 1983).
  3. A. Abragam, Principles of Nuclear Magnetism, Oxford University Press, 1961.
